A majority of people trust that doctors and other medical professionals will treat them with the care they need. However, serious mistakes can occur in any type of healthcare environment.
Medical malpractice lawyers must prove that a physician violated his or her duty of care and that this breach directly led to the injury you suffered. Special damages can be awarded to pay for any out-of-pocket expenses like lost wages.
Incorrect diagnosis
In a perfect world doctors would be able to diagnose accurately any health issues that patients may be suffering from, and provide them with the correct treatment plans. Doctors are humans and may make mistakes. If their mistakes lead to the development of a chronic illness, Medical Malpractice Attorneys complications, or a treatment that is ineffective or even death, they could be considered to be negligent.
When it comes to misdiagnosis, the legal definition is straightforward "a inability to provide an accurate diagnosis in a prompt manner." To be eligible for compensation, you must prove that your physician violated their duty of care, and that this led to a more adverse than expected clinical outcome for you. A misdiagnosis lawyer is able to determine if you have a case that is valid.
You will need to show that a doctor with the same qualifications and experience would have made a correct diagnoses in a similar scenario. This is accomplished through differential diagnosis. This involves identifying all illnesses that may be causing your symptoms, and then testing for each at a time until a final diagnosis is determined.
You can recover both general and special damages if you can prove your doctor ignored or Medical Malpractice Attorneys did not carry out this procedure or if he/she did not even notice your symptoms. Special damages include out-of pocket expenses such as past or future medical expenses lost earnings and pharmacy charges and therapy costs, as well as equipment purchases, and any other related expenses. General damages cover more intangible expenses like discomfort and pain as well as loss of quality and life, as well as a shorter life expectancy.
Inability to recognize
Many serious medical conditions, such as heart attacks, cancer, and appendicitis are treatable when they are identified at an early stage. If medical professionals aren't successful in the early detection of these ailments, they may cause serious injury or even death.
When doctors miss a diagnosis and fail to fulfill their professional responsibilities and can be held liable for mistakes. A successful medical malpractice case hinges on proving that the physician deviated from the acceptable standard of treatment, causing physical harm to the patient. Your lawyer will make use of medical records and expert testimony to prove the healthcare professional did not practice the same level of care as colleagues with similar experience and training.
It's important to remember that not every medical error that results in a missed diagnosis is grounds for an action. Certain conditions are difficult to recognize, especially if they're in the very early stages. It's essential to see your doctor as soon as possible if you begin to notice signs of illness. Treatment Faults
We all know that doctors and medical staff are human beings, and are likely to make mistakes. When those mistakes are serious, however, resulting in injury or death, the patient or their family could be able to file a malpractice claim. Treatment errors can range from prescribing a wrong medication to putting an instrument in the body of a patient following surgery. It is also possible that a physician isn't following the patient's condition and they end up with a more serious health issue as consequence.
Doctors should keep meticulous medical records for every patient they see, which contains medical history, a list of medications the patient takes, as well as any allergies the patient suffers from. Documentation errors are the root of many medical malpractice claims, and even a minor mistake like putting an incorrect dosage on a prescription could cause serious harm to the patient.
In New York, the burden of evidence in a medical mishap case rests with the victim. To prove that the medical provider did not meet their duty of care, they need to present an expert witness who can present the accepted standard of care and the way in which the defendant failed to meet the requirements. Negligence
Medical professionals could be liable if they stray from the accepted standard of care and cause harm to patients. The standard of care is the amount of skill and caution a reasonably prudent healthcare provider would have used under similar circumstances. Your attorney must establish that the doctor was in violation of the standard of care and that the doctor's negligence caused your injuries.
It isn't easy to prove negligence in a case of malpractice because healthcare professionals are held at an elevated standard due to the fact that they are trained daily to save lives. Humans are susceptible to error and the healthcare field does not differ.
If, for example, surgeons make a mistake using a foreign object or operates on the wrong side, it is regarded as malpractice. You may be entitled compensation for your damages. If the negligence resulted in the death of a loved one, family members could also be entitled to compensation.
Economic damages are based on current and future medical malpractice lawsuits expenses as well as loss of income or loss of consortium (companionship), pain, and suffering. A jury will weigh these factors when deciding how much they will award you for your losses. Your lawyer will call on experts to assist in proving your medical and non-economic damages. Experts will testify the reality that the doctor breached his duty of care and that the negligence directly caused your injuries.
